Andrew Crawford (Smarthinge) came up with the design. Brusso do a similar hinge but it has a square knuckle which may sound like a minor thing but is quite noticeable on a small box. Unfortunately Andrew didn’t patent his design and hence it has been copied. I try and support Andrew by buying from him as he came up with the design and has been tenacious in seeking a manufacturer who can work to his high standards. He’s also a top bloke!
